BUSCAR UN DATO Y DEVOLVER LA DIRECCION DONDE APUNTA
Verificar que la lista tenga nodos
Utilizar Q para recorrer la lista
Mientras que Q se dezplaza hasta el final
Se compara y vereifica si el nodo ya se encontro
Si se encuentra se retorna a Q que contiene la direccion
Si no lo encuentra en ese nodo se pone a apuntar al siguiente nodo
Se finaliza la condición para comparar
Se finaliza el ciclo
Se finaliza la condicion de la lista vacia
Si se recorre y no se encuentra el dato, se retorna una
direccion en este caso NULL determina que la información
correspondiente a un nodo no se encontro
Fin del metodo
PSEUDOCODIGO
INSERTAR ANTES UN NODO DADO COMO REFERENCIA
PSEUDOCOGICO
Se toman como parametros el valor insertar y la direccion del nodo
Si hay un solo nodo se invoca al metodo "insertar al inicio"
Si no es es unico nodo(se debe recorrer hasta el nodo indicado por el parametro)
Se debe tener referencia al nodo anterior a B para el nuevo nodo
Se desplaza a Q para el siguiente nodo
Se crea el nuevo nodo y se enlaza con Q
Se enlaza al nuevo con el anterior
Fin de si
Fin del metodo
INSERTAR DESPUES DE UN NODO DADO COMO REFERENCIA
PSEUDOCODIGO
Se toman como parametros el valor a insertar y la
direccion del nodo
Se crea el nuevo nodo
Se enlaza con el nodo siguiente
Se enlaza con el nodo anterior (B) con el nodo nuevo